Stage Collapses At Indiana State Fair

 

15 August 2011

The Indiana State Fair has ended in tragedy, with five people being killed after a stage collapsed.

The roof of the stage was torn off just before the band Sugarland were due to perform.

"The wind just picked up and the stage just caught and the roof just caught and it went up like a sail and then it crashed forward into the people standing in the front. There were people trapped underneath and everyone was running and screaming," said Kirby Ehler of local NewsChannel 15. "They were asking any medics or nurses not to leave."

"We are all right," Sugarland tweeted. "We are praying for our fans, and the people of Indianapolis. We hope you'll join us. They need your strength."

Sara Bareilles, who had taken to the stage earlier in the day, tweeted, "I'm speechless and feel so helpless. Please send love and prayers to Indianapolis tonight. My heart aches for the lives lost."
